1 definition by One-Shot sally

Top Definition
Where you use something once, and it gets the job done.
David is a one shot sally. Damn this one gun in MW3 that only reloads once in a lifetime but kills a butt load of kids in one shot is a one shot sally.
by One-Shot sally February 24, 2012
Mug icon
Buy a one shot sally mug!